Spicy Pork Bulgogi With Rice
Whip up some Seoul food with this easy bulgogi. You'll pan-fry pork slices in a sweet 'n' spicy gochujang sauce before serving with rice. Sprinkle over spring onion and dig in.

Heat a large, wide-based pan (preferably non-stick) with a drizzle of vegetable oil over a high heat
Once hot, add your pork strips with a pinch of salt
Cook for 3-4 min or until the pork is beginning to brown
Tip: Cooking for 4 or more? Use 2 pans!

Meanwhile, top, tail, peel and slice your carrot[s] into discs, then chop into batons
Peel and finely slice your brown onion[s]

Once the pork has started to brown, add the chopped carrot and sliced onion to the pan[s] and cook for 3-4 min or until softened

Squeeze your pouch[es] of cooked white long grain rice to separate the grains
Tear the top corner of the pouch[es] (just a little!) and microwave for 2 min or until piping hot
Tip: If you're cooking two or more pouches, pop them in together but increase the microwave cook time accordingly

Combine your gluten free soy sauce, ginger & garlic paste, gochujang paste (can't handle the heat? Go easy!), mirin and toasted sesame oil – this is your bulgogi sauce

Once softened, add the bulgogi sauce and cook for 1-2 min or until coated and slightly thickened, and the pork is cooked through (no pink meat!) – this is your spicy pork bulgogi
Trim, then slice your spring onion[s]

Serve the spicy pork bulgogi with the cooked rice to the side
Garnish with the sliced spring onion
